Inventory in a spreadsheet breaks when you have multiple locations, multiple team members updating stock, and movements that need to be tracked (received, sold, transferred, returned, adjusted).

What spreadsheet inventory can't handle:

  • Multiple warehouses or locations (which location has which stock?)
  • Concurrent edits by multiple team members (race conditions on quantity)
  • Receiving workflow (PO matching, quantity verification)
  • Real-time stock depletion as orders are processed
  • Reorder point alerts when stock drops below threshold

When custom inventory makes sense: Your product types have custom attributes (serial numbers, batch numbers, expiry dates). Your locations don't fit standard warehouse models. Your receiving and fulfillment workflow is specific.
